    Who is Lesya Ukrainka?Lesya Ukrainka ( Ukrainian: Леся Українка, romanized : Lesia Ukrainka, pronounced [ˈlɛsʲɐ ʊkrɐˈjinkɐ]; born Larysa Petrivna Kosach, Ukrainian: Лариса Петрівна Косач; 25 February [ O.S. 13 February] 1871 – 1 August [ O.S. 19 July] 1913) was one of Ukrainian literature 's foremost writers, best known for her poems and plays.

    Why did Lesya Ukrainka choose a pseudonym?The author chose the pseudonym Ukrainka, according to one of the versions, to emphasize her place of origin, which was Naddniprianshchyna, not Galicia. Lesya Ukrainka started being published at a young age, initially focusing on poetry before slowly discovering her affinity for longer forms. After her European tour, she turned to drama.
